Basic: Welcome to the prehistoric times! In today's world we may think that we have all the knowledge, but can modern sims last in this ancient time? Like most challenges you must start with humble beginnings -
1) Start with five couples, each with one adult male and one adult female. Create two couples with Skin 4, two couples with Skin 1, and one couple of mixed, ie. one adult has skin 2 and one adult has skin 3. Each couple is to move into a small lot placed next to each other and near water.
2) The couples are only allowed to interact with each other; they may not greet townies or NPCs.
3) The couples are to try for babies as frequently as possible. As soon as one baby is born then try for another.
4) They cannot get jobs or visit a community lot of any sort. They are to make their living by farming, and survive by farming (including orchards) and fishing as the only food source. You cannot do anything else to earn money - including digging for treasure.
5) Their funds upon moving in should be set to $3000.
6) Seasons are set to Summer all year round.
7) Objects allowed include: 5 beds (hammocks, tents, or the lowest cost single/double bed. Double beds and tents count as two beds), 1 cheap loveseat, 1 cheap stove, 1 cheap counter, 1 cheap phone, the cheapest table and 3 cheap chairs, 5 farming plots or fruit trees (you can buy more as you get the money), a pond (not too big) one sink, one toilet stall or cheapest toilet, one cheap dresser, one fridge (this can only be used to get baby bottles, and to serve up a meal that the family has either grown or caught).
8) Once the kids grow up they are to each buy the same size lot as their parents and have their funds set to match the family's funds; with the exception of the eldest two who get to live on their parents farm.
9) As soon as the oldest Generation 3 child becomes adult move on to the next stage.
10) Ranks for the next stage are developed based on which family has the most money.
To find out who has the highest rank, take any family with the same last name and of skin colour 1 and 2 and add their funds together.
Example: Melissa and John Smith have Skin 1, and their son Mike also has Skin 1, and is married to Jane Thomas who has Skin 2. Because Jane took Mike's last name she is now also a Smith, therefore you add the total money between Melissa and John's family with Jane and Mike's family. You do the same for each family.
The family with the most money is the New Emperor, next is the Patricians, next is the Plebeians, and then next is the Slaves. There should be more slaves than plebeians, more plebeians than patricians, and only one Emperor family. However, only people with Skin 1 and 2 can be Emperors or Patricians, unless they marry up ranks.
